Skip to content

Commit 6dd232f

Browse files
committed
permissions
1 parent 4959b08 commit 6dd232f

1 file changed

Lines changed: 2 additions & 10 deletions

File tree

ghost.php

Lines changed: 2 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-43,18 +43,10 @@ public function setup( $args ) {
4343

4444
// Create nodeapp folder and 'Absolute' copy over ghost files
4545
$cmd = "mkdir -p " . escapeshellarg( $ghost_folder ) . " ; ";
46+
$cmd .= "chmod 751 " . escapeshellarg( $nodeapp_folder ) . " && ";
4647
$cmd .= __DIR__ . '/abcopy "/opt/ghost/" "' . $ghost_folder . '" && ';
47-
$cmd .= "chown -R $user:$user " . escapeshellarg( $nodeapp_folder ) . " ; ";
48+
$cmd .= "chown -R $user:$user " . escapeshellarg( $nodeapp_folder );
4849

49-
// // Create the nodeapp folder
50-
51-
// $cmd .= "chown -R $user:$user " . escapeshellarg( $nodeapp_folder ) . " ; ";
52-
// $cmd .= 'runuser -l ' . $user . ' -c "cd ' . escapeshellarg( $ghost_folder ) . ' && ';
53-
// $cmd .= 'export NVM_DIR=/opt/nvm && source /opt/nvm/nvm.sh && nvm use v18 && ';
54-
// $cmd .= 'ghost install --url https://' . $domain . ' --db mysql --dbhost 127.0.0.1 --dbuser ';
55-
// $cmd .= $dbUser . ' --dbpass ' . $dbPassword;
56-
// $cmd .= ' --port 3306 --dbname ' . $dbName . ' --mail Sendmail';
57-
// $cmd .= ' --process local --dir ' . $ghost_folder . ' --no-prompt --no-setup-nginx"';
5850
$hcpp->log( $cmd );
5951
$hcpp->log( shell_exec( $cmd ) );
6052

0 commit comments

Comments
 (0)